Jaz was 43 inches tall. Eighteen months later she was 52 inches tall. Find the constant rate of change of jaz's height

Respuesta :

jgajaifwh jgajaifwh
  • 09-01-2019

Answer:

.5 inches a month


Step-by-step explanation:

52 - 43 = 9 inches


9/18 = .5
